What is the difference between Opening vs Cashier?

AspectOpeningCashier
Required CredentialsBasic training, on-the-job trainingBasic math skills, cash handling experience
Work EnvironmentPre-shift setup, preparing the store for openingHandling transactions, customer service
Employer & Industry UsageRetail stores, restaurants, hotelsRetail, supermarkets, restaurants
Common Search & ComparisonOpening vs Cashier

Opening staff focus on preparing the business for daily operations, including setting up cash registers and ensuring the store is ready for customers. Cashiers handle transactions, assist customers, and manage cash flow during business hours. While both roles are essential in retail and hospitality, openings are primarily pre-shift tasks, whereas cashiers are active during customer service hours.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in an Opening role, and how can they be overcome?

Professionals in an Opening role, such as an opening shift supervisor or team member, often face challenges like managing early start times, ensuring all opening procedures are completed efficiently, and setting the pace for the rest of the day. Staying organized and following a detailed checklist can help ensure nothing is overlooked during the opening process. Additionally, clear communication with team members is essential for addressing any issues that arise and for handing off tasks as shifts change. Consistency in following protocols and adapting to unexpected situations will make the opening process smoother over time.

What are 'Openings' in a job context?

In a job context, 'openings' refer to available positions or roles within a company or organization that are currently seeking to be filled. These job openings can be in various departments and at different levels of experience, depending on the needs of the employer. Candidates interested in employment typically search for job openings that match their skills and career interests. Companies advertise openings through job boards, their own websites, or recruitment agencies. Applying to suitable job openings is the first step in the hiring process.
